The gtk3 reference on resource files,  
gtk+-3.0.2/docs/reference/gtk/html/gtk3-Resource-Files.html,states that,  
although deprecated,      "certain files will be read at the end of 
gtk_init().        Unless modified, the files looked for will be      
<SYSCONFDIR>/gtk-2.0/gtkrc and .gtkrc-3.0 in the users home directory."
My experience with the ~/.gtkrc-3.0 file when running my application compiled 
against gtk+-3.0.2is that it has no effect at all.
Specifically,   I have a file named both gtkrc-2.0 and gtkrc-3.0  (both 
hard-linked to same content which I show below)
When I compile my app against gtk-2 and run it,  I see the expected result,with 
the HighContrast theme applied to borders etc and the text of my GtkEntry 
entryBox in  Binner Gothic font.
When I compile the same app against gtk-3 and run it in the same way (without 
any XDG_CONFIG_HOME or any use of any new gtk-3 settings features such as a 
settings.ini,  css styles etc,i.e. trying to simulate a simple migration with 
only re-bulding the app),I see plain old Raleigh and the Sans 10 font for the 
text in the entrybox.
Am I doing something wrong or is this a bug ?  (in the documentation or in the 
code?)
By the way,  yes,  I did verify that my gtk3 build is in effect in my gtk3 
scenario -I set up a settings.ini and css stylesheet as another variation,  and 
triedwith a new-to-gtk3 widget (lightswitch)  and then get my settings applied 
and thelight-switch works as expected.
